Urinary Tract Infection (UTI) Testing is a diagnostic test that helps identify the presence of bacteria or other pathogens in the urinary system. UTIs are common infections that can affect the bladder, kidneys, ureters, or urethra. This testing plays a crucial role in the accurate and timely diagnosis of UTIs, allowing healthcare providers to prescribe appropriate treatment and prevent complications.
If you reside in Alto, Texas, and experience symptoms such as frequent urination, burning sensation during urination, cloudy or bloody urine, or pelvic pain, UTI Testing is recommended. UTIs can affect individuals of all ages, but they are more common in women. Additionally, those with risk factors such as urinary catheter use, urinary tract abnormalities, or a history of UTIs may also benefit from testing.

The interpretation of UTI Testing results involves analyzing the presence of bacteria or other pathogens in the urine sample. Positive results indicate a urinary tract infection, while negative results may require further investigation to rule out other potential causes of symptoms.

After UTI Testing, healthcare providers will discuss the results with individuals and prescribe appropriate treatment if a UTI is confirmed. It is crucial to follow the prescribed medication regimen and drink plenty of fluids to flush out the infection.
